Bosnia: EUFOR Rescued Family out of Kalinovik

06 February 2012 - 

During the night between 4 and 5 February, EUFOR was requested by Bosnian authorities to conduct an air rescue operation in the area of Kalinovik. There, a family of four (three adults and one child) had become cut off from civilization by heavy snowfall.

Search and Rescue Operation

On Monday, a search and rescue helicopter from Camp Butimr’s Austrian Helicopter Detachment was deployed. The helicopter crew started to reconnoitre the area of Kalinovik, and decided to evacuate the family immediately because of the good weather conditions. The three adults and child boarded the helicopter safely and were brought to Camp Butmir, where they underwent medical examination by EUFOR personnel before being taken to hospital.

Soldiers Clean Streets and Tracks

While this rescue operation took place, soldiers of the Multinational Battalion continued to clear streets and tracks of snow. Currently, they are concentrating on freeing the tramway tracks in the city of Sarajevo.
